Guide to visiting El Calafate: discover the attractions of this Patagonian destination

El Calafate

El Calafate is a city located in the province of Santa Cruz, in Argentine Patagonia. It is mainly known for being the gateway to Los Glaciares National Park and its famous Perito Moreno glacier.
